Top Tips for Getting your Resume Noticed Online
- Write a compelling chronological resume. Highlight results you achieved in previous jobs.
- Use high impact, relevant keywords to get noticed and be found. Employers & Recruiters use keywords to search the resume bank and their internal Applicant Tracking Systems (much like how you use Google). Think keywords!
- Keep your resume updated.
- Refresh your Resume often--the most recent resumes come up first in specific search results.

- Apply to individual jobs you are interested in and qualified for. Don't only expect Employers/Recruiters to find you in a Resume Bank.
- Write personalized cover letters highlighting why you are the Best candidate for the job. Focus on opportunities; tell the potential employer how you can make an impact.
- Make sure you have a professional presence online starting with LinkedIn.
- Check to make sure that all your social networking accounts are employer & recruiter ready. (They will look!)
